[...] In 2022, Missing Children Europe has been closely monitoring the status of the New Pact for Migration and Asylum, with a particular focus on the revision of the Anti-trafficking Directive, the Voluntary Solidarity Mechanism, the relocation of unaccompanied migrant children, and the EURODAC Regulation updates.
